It's Positive! You're Pregnant! Well technically, you aren't pregnant. That would be a medical miracle. Your wife is pregnant. But you are expecting, too, in a way. You're not a dad yet - you're a DUE DAD...and you don't have a clue what to expect about paternity and being a new dad (in the long term) and having a pregnant wife in the short term. Don't panic - the good news is that you've made it through the 'typically-more-difficult first trimester'.
In this lesson, Second Trimester Part 2, the DadLabs dads (all experienced but not so distantly so that they don't know what you're going through and what you need to watch out for) talk you through all kinds of things, including:
- Sleep
- Foot massages
- Sex during pregnancy
- Doctor visits in the second trimester
- Being a new dad

DadLabs is an information and entertainment company headquartered in Austin, Texas, that fosters the father/child relationship through media, instructional and retail products. The mission of the company is to strengthen families and benefit children by empowering today's fathers. The company provides resources to expecting, new and veteran fathers that will launch them into a more active and creative role in the lives of their children. DadLabs speaks to the corporate executive and the delivery driver with a voice that is authentic and genuinely male, with wisdom and self-deprecating humor of experience.
